The Czech FNL has also reached its knockout phase for Dukla Praha and Vysočina Jihlava, so there is no league table to reference. Dukla arrive off two straight 1-3 defeats, the most recent away at Ústí nad Labem, following a 3-0 win and a 2-2 draw. Vysočina Jihlava, meanwhile, lost their latest round 0-1 at home to Táborsko, after two heavy wins by 4-0 and 5-1. In the head-to-head record, however, Dukla Praha have the clear upper hand, having won all five recorded meetings, the most recent by 1-0 in September 2025.
